Rotten edges.

The first category is big.

Rotten edges

The cause of formation is the NEP impurity on the weft yarn, especially the large impurities on the middle and fine yarn, and the details produced by the spinning and spinning of the spun yarn, which is caused by the collision of the weft winding air ring, resulting in unexpected resistance.

In the weft cavity, there is a waste wire, which is released from the small eye of the weft head due to the impact of the shuttle, blocking the shuttle's riding wire or the porcelain eye passage, resulting in the obstruction of the weft yarn and the increase of tension.

When the loom is wiped, the flying flowers fall into the porcelain eye of the shuttle so that the weft yarn can not expand smoothly and increase the unexpected tension.

Poor matching of shuttle pipe, different center of the shuttle, uneven height of spindle core, high and low core of shuttle core, wear of weft hole, all will make the tension of weft yarn unevenness seriously unevenness.


Elimination method.

To improve the quality of weft yarn, according to the different weaving types, the specific requirements of raw yarn neps impurities are put forward.

The weft hole of the weft hole should be solved. The weaving workshop should be combined with the regular repair of the weft pipe to eliminate it.

When cleaning looms, the shuttles should be covered with cover cloth to prevent flying flowers from falling into and blocking the shuttle's porcelain eye.

Do the matching work of shuttle and pipe.


The causes of the second kinds of small rotten edges.

The side support is not enough to extend the amplitude, while the side support needling force is insufficient, and the side yarn is not well controlled.

Especially when weft yarn is gradually rewinding from full yarn to small yarn, it is more prominent.

The middle and special weave fabric with high shrinkage ratio of warp and weft yarn is too small on the side and side yarns, or the side yarn itself is worn wrong, so it can not withstand the severe friction of the reed during beating up. It will cause broken edges and small rotten edges.

When the shuttles are full, if the warp tension is too high or the tension difference between the sides of the warp is very different, the larger side of the tension will cause the weft yarn with high tensile force to stretch out with the edge of the reed gear when it hits the weft.


Elimination method.

Carefully check the state of the spear rollers and correct the position of the side brace, which is in line with the technological requirements.

The position of the reed should be corrected, especially to prevent the upper warp from being pressed by the reed cap when the shuttles are full, and the unexpected tension of the whole warp and side yarns will be affected.

The hoist should meet the technological requirements.

In the normal operation of the loom, the reed should not touch the side brace, and the bumper should not touch the stop button to prevent broken edges and small rotten edges.


  

Burrs

Causes of formation.

Side support scissors failed, Osa Mi cut into the fabric mouth.

The weft of the shuttle is interrupted at the shuttles.

Using the probe inducing shuttle device, the safety yarn on the weft pipe is replaced by the shuttle in the end when the shuttle is replaced, and the other end is still in the weaving port.

When the weft is cut by the side scissors, the tail yarn remains on the shuttle board. Due to the movement of the shuttle, the yarn tail will be brought into the weaving mouth every few shuttle, thus forming a beard like fringe.


Elimination method.

The side supporting scissors are well matched and installed correctly.
